Q: Is 15,058,295 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 15,058,295 is not a prime number.

Why is 15,058,295 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 15058295 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 35 181 905 1,267 2,377 6,335 11,885 16,639 83,195 430,237 2,151,185 3,011,659 and 15,058,295, with no remainder.

Since 15,058,295 cannot be divided by just 1 and 15,058,295, it is not a prime number.
